An important early text was German physiologist Wilhelm Preyer’s 1882 The Mind of the Child, in which he described the development of his own daughter from birth through childhood. Developmental psychology, also called Life-span Psychology, the branch of psychology concerned with the changes in cognitive, motivational, psychophysiological, and social functioning that occur throughout the human life span.During the 19th and early 20th centuries, developmental psychologists were concerned primarily with child psychology.
